Maurice Kügler is a scholar working on Economics and Econometrics, General Economics, Econometrics and Finance and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Maurice Kügler has authored 60 papers receiving a total of 2.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 36 papers in Economics and Econometrics, 26 papers in General Economics, Econometrics and Finance and 17 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Maurice Kügler's work include Global trade and economics (24 papers), Firm Innovation and Growth (14 papers) and Knowledge Management and Sharing (8 papers). Maurice Kügler is often cited by papers focused on Global trade and economics (24 papers), Firm Innovation and Growth (14 papers) and Knowledge Management and Sharing (8 papers). Maurice Kügler coll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Germany. Maurice Kügler's co-authors include Eric Verhoogen, Adriana D. Kugler, Klaus Neusser, Hillel Rapoport, Marcela Eslava, John Haltiwanger, Stefan Smolnik, Jonathan Eaton, James Tybout and Yves Zénou and has published in prestigious journals such as American Economic Review, The Review of Economics and Statistics and The Review of Economic Studies.
